June 10, 2009 - Available in 2 sizes to cover varying plant air supplies, air operated actuators mount on standard valve body to provide remote control capabilities in process applications. Piston style offers dependable operation and extended actuator cycle life, while yoke style design, which offers separation from process fluids and actuator air pressure, also indicates stem position. Offered in NO or NC configurations, both styles are made of corrosion-resistant anodized aluminum.

Updated Air Valve Actuators


Fairview, PA - June 3, 2009 - Maxpro Technologies announces the availability of newly designed air operated valve actuators. These actuators are a piston type design, and are mounted on a standard valve body to provide remote control capabilities in process applications.

Two styles of air actuators are available, and selection is based on the valve size, system pressure and air pressure available. The piston style valve offers dependable operation and a longer actuator cycle life. The yoke style design offers separation from process fluids and actuator air pressure. This design also indicated stem position and allows for easy stem replacement.

The actuators are available in two different sizes to cover varying plant air supplies. They are made of anodized aluminum, which provides good corrosion resistance, and are available in normally open or normally closed configurations.

Maxpro Technologies offers a complete line of high pressure valves, fittings and tubing as well as a complete line of air driven pumps, air amplifiers and gas boosters.
